How to organize podcast channels into folders?

I'm brand-new to iTunes so maybe I'm just not figuring it out: I have lots of podcasts and it would be helpful to be able to organize them by general topic area (Project Management, Health Care, Cooking, etc.) How can this be done? Creating a playlist doesn't work because it lists all of the individual shows, all together. Any help would be appreciated.

You should be able to do it with smart playlists rather than playlists. Set up the smart playlist to match ANY of the rules you list. Then set up rules that match on Artist or Album. It's not exactly what you're trying to do, and it definitely takes a little work, but it helps me get organized. I have a handful of podcasts that are my favorites, so I keep those in a smart playlist. But I'm always trying new ones, so I also use a Recently Added Podcasts playlist that includes everything of Genre = Podcast.

  • How to organize j2me classes into packages?

    Hello!
    I'm using Wireless Toolkit 2.5.2 and I have got a question about it.
    Does anybody know, how to organize j2me classes into packages?
    As far as I know, all source files should be placed inside WTK_home_directory\apps\my_project\src folder.
    Although it is possible to create arbitrary folder structure (for example, src\com\my_company\www\my_package) and successfully compile the project,
    it's not possible to run it on the emulator or any target device. Trying to do it, I get ClassNotFound exception.
    It's not surprisingly, because virtual machine on the device doesn't know, where to look for desired classes.
    So the question is how to add new entries to the device classpath (of course, if it exists)?
    And is it possible to configure it through application descriptor (jad) file somehow?
    Any ideas, references, descriptions?
    Thanks in advance,
    A.

    Hello!
    So, I have found the solution and this question is not actual any more.
    The solution is quite simple - you have to properly configure application jad-file.
    It can be done like this (in ktoolbar):
    1. Open project settings from main menu (Project - Settings).
    2. Then go to MIDlets tab.
    3. There you have to change value in "*class*" column (for example, to smth like this - com.my_company.www.my_package.my_midlet_class_name).
    4. Press Ok button.
    Having done these steps, you will be able to have any package structure you need
    (because after it AMS on the device will know where to look for your application class files).

    j.v. wrote:
    it is creating an alias in that smart mailbox
    I have heard this statement before, but it is not true. A message in a Smart Mailbox (or a file in a Smart Folder in the Finder) is not an alias. It is simply the same original in a different context.
    An alias, in Mac OS terminology, is a separate and distinct file from the original. It is a file whose property is that, when opened, it redirects and opens a different file (the "original"). But the alias itself is a distinct file. It can be renamed, moved, deleted, labeled, etc., without having any effect on the original. None of this is true of the "contents" of a Smart Mailbox/Folder. If you delete a message in a Smart Mailbox, you are deleting the original message. If you drag the message to a (non-Smart) Mailbox, you are moving the original. Some people seem to be confused that a message (or file) can appear to be in more than one place at a time. It is, nevertheless, the exact same message, and misunderstanding this point could have unfortunate consequences.

    The cloud-and-arrow symbol is nothing to do with iCloud. It indicates that the episode is available to download from the author's server. iTunes can automatically download new episodes - check your settings (in the bottom right-hand corner when you are subscribed to at least one podcast):
    Set 'Show' to 'Feed'; click 'Settings' and set 'Download episodes' to 'On'.
    When you subscribe to a podcast which already has a number of episodes only the latest one will download automatically (on the assumption that you may not want to download what might be two or three hundred episodes) so you will have to download manually any other episode; but after that it should download the latest episode.

    On your Mac, option+Save As… . In the File Save chooser, click the small black triangle adjacent to the filename. You want this black triangle facing up so the expanded Save As panel is visible. Now, you can either navigate to and open (double-click) existing folders where you want to save your current document, or on the bottom panel is the New Folder button.
    The File Save As chooser window does not support drag and drop as one might expect from a true Finder window. If you were to drag and drop a document from the Desktop into this Save As window, not only would it not copy, but it would switch the location of your Save As window to the Desktop.

  • HELP!  I'm going crazy trying to organize my music into folders!

    I am managing my own music which I need to do.
    I've now got thousands of playlists, each usually an album or artist name. For example I've got over 33 Madonna albums. Just my "A's" to get through on the playlist require my thumb to go around the wheel dozens of times.
    I need to have folders, I would like to name them "A" and have all my playlists that start with A under them. I'm thinking "M" followed by a subfolder "Madonna" followed by a playlist with a playlist for each Madonna album.
    It is not letting me do any of this. I can make a folder but then it won't let me drag it to my ipod. I create a folder and try to drag a playlist into it and it won't let me. I can't deal with this much music anymore. There has to be a way to use folders for this.

    It's not difficult to use but if you are used to doing it a differnt way, it may be confusing.
    You're gonna have to try to not apply what you used to do.
    In iTunes, go to menu Edit - Show browser.
    This will show a list of Genres, Artists and Albums.
    Click on any of these to view just that info.
    Same on the iPod.
    Go to Music -> Artists -> Albums
    or Music -> Genre -> Artist
    or Music Albums
    or Music -> Playists.
    Yes, you can create folders in iTunes under playlists. This will help keep your playlists a bit organized.
    I have two folders, one for my playlists and one for my daughters playlists.
    However, these folder do not get transfered over to the iPod. Only the playlists get transfered.
    To get Artist>Album>Playlist, on the iPod, use Music -> Artist -> Album and press Play.
    In iTunes select the artist and the album and press play.
    You don't need a playlist for an artist or album.
    To play all songs by an artist (or Genre) , simply select the artist and press Play
    iTunes and the iPod are not as friendly for classical music. Many people edit the ID3 tags to exchange the Composer and Artist fields. This way everything from Strauss will be shown under Strauss instead of the 27 different orchestras who recorded Strauss.

    Sure enough, when I tried it today I did find that missing step. When looking at the Home Page of the iPhone or any page being worked on, in the lower right hand corner two buttons say
    SYNC APPLY
    I do not recall using the APPLY button on the first day trying this, but I used it this time.
    After making changes, I hit APPLY and the computer began to sync with the iPhone.
    This time, although there is nothing telling the user what is going on, the sync actually makes the iPhone pages to look exactly like the pages created on the Mac.
    Too bad the instructions and help did not say to do things in this way, which is the only correct way, as far as I can tell.
    I have about 155 apps on the iPhone, making the job extra lengthy. However, I never could do it on the iPhone’s tiny screen, even though it is possible, so this was good - working on the larger screen of the MacBook.
    There are also some (undocumented?) tricks in using the MacBook for this task. For example, it is possible to create a folder and then, using the list of all apps on the iPhone that is on the left side of screen, open the folder, click on the check box next to any app you want to put in the folder and it will jump right in!
    If the check box already has a check mark, just click the box to remove it, click again to put the check mark in the box and voila the app takes off for the folder. This also works to just put apps onto a certain page, if you want to do that, but dragging apps around sometimes works better.

    The Views menu in the Bookmarks Manager (Bookmarks > Show All Bookmarks) is for displaying the bookmarks in different sorting orders (hence the name Views) and doesn't sort bookmarks permanently.
    In Firefox the option to sort bookmarks is only available for folders and not for individual bookmarks.<br />
    Easiest to sort by name is to do that in the left pane of the Bookmarks Manager (Bookmarks > Show All Bookmarks) and right-click the folder that you want to sort.
